WebOct 7, 2024 · Scalp Eczema and Hair Loss Seborrheic dermatitis does not typically cause hair loss. That being said, excessive scratching due to an itchy or irritated scalp can damage hair follicles and result in hair loss. Inflammation on the scalp can also make it difficult for hair to grow. WebJun 30, 2024 · A thorough physical examination: To evaluate visible symptoms. A thorough family history: To find out about hereditary scalp conditions (such as psoriasis) in the family. A pull test: To measure the amount of hair loss for those with alopecia. A scalp biopsy: A test to view a sample of tissue under a microscope to determine the type of scalp …

The causes of female pattern baldness are not wholly understood, but the condition is thought to be genetic in nature and related to levels of male and female sex hormones.
